Comprehensive Primary and Specialized Healthcare Services at University Health Facilities
University Health Lakewood Medical Center offers residents of Eastern Jackson County access to a modern community hospital with a continuum of outpatient services designed to meet the needs of families. This 110-bed hospital provides patients with easy access for acute and well-care needs for all ages, and a focus on primary care. Key specialty services lines include obstetrics and women's care, orthopaedics, and geriatrics.
Primary and Specialty Care at Lakewood
The University Health Primary Care Lakewood Pavilion is a primary care clinic located on the University Health Lakewood Medical Center campus where family medicine physicians provide well care, preventive medicine and care for those with chronic illnesses. Patients have access to a laboratory and diagnostic imaging within the hospital and an extensive list of specialty care services. These include:
- Cardiac testing and Cardiology
- Dental care and Diabetes management
- Emergency care and Endocrinology
- Gastroenterology and Neurology
- Maternity and NICU
- Orthopaedics and Sports medicine
- Surgical care and Telehealth
Furthermore, the University Health Women's Care Lakewood Family Birthplace delivers more than 1500 babies annually, and the Surgery center provides access to a Joint Commission advanced certified hip and knee replacement program. For older adults, the Lakewood Care Center provides seniors access to a residential long-term care facility.
Family Medicine Residency Clinic at UH Parma Medical Center
Family medicine residents, supervised by longtime UH family practice physicians, are now accepting patients at their new clinic at University Hospitals Parma Medical Center. “We see the complete range of medical situations, from babies to senior citizens,” says Michael E. Saridakis, DO, Medical Director of the Residency Clinic. Residents can care for all forms of acute care conditions, physical examinations, vaccinations and injuries like sprains and lacerations. They also perform osteopathic manipulative treatment for back and neck problems.
The clinic takes walk-in patients and can serve as a family doctor’s office with scheduled appointments. Patients are seen first by the resident physician, who confers with the supervising physician. This is essentially a training center for family doctors to learn the full spectrum of family practice.

UH Health Family Care Center and Tilman J. Fertitta Family College of Medicine
The UH Health Family Care Center offers affordable, comprehensive primary care services in one convenient location. At this facility, you will find Tilman J. Fertitta Family College of Medicine doctors taking care of you and your family. All doctors are Fertitta Family College of Medicine faculty, offering a one-stop-shop for the whole family with same-day / next-day appointments.
To ensure accessibility, the center provides a sliding fee scale based on income and household size. The clinic's services include Primary Care, Behavioral Health, Women's Health, Pediatrics, and Telehealth.
